Forum on the Future of Artificial Intelligence in the Academic Sector
His Excellency the President of King Khalid University, Prof. Dr. Faleh bin Raja Allah Al-Solami, witnessed this morning the launch of the “Forum for the Future of Artificial Intelligence in the Academic Sector,” which was organized by the College of Science in cooperation with the College of Computer Science and the Center for Artificial Intelligence, in the presence of about 2,000 beneficiaries...

Event: “I will be one day I want to be”
The College of Science Club - Female Section, in cooperation with the Deanship of Student Affairs for female students’ affairs and in partnership with the College of Home Economics Club and the College of Pharmacy, held an event: “I will be one day what I want.”
This is on Tuesday, 4/30 1445 AH. It is a program that supports and develops female students’ cognitive and skill capabilities that enable them to enter the labor market.
